Like many of the "new" sports car variants at PAG over the years, the "pepper" has had its detractors.... some justified in that the early production models (affectionately called alpha (03) beta (04), there was a VERY BAD implementation by PAG. Needless glitches, poor design etc. on components to the vehicle.. however, the engine, suspension, "wow" factor in driving an off-road vehicle led many of us to "grin and bear it". However, the Cayenne has now become a much better vehicle and the Cayman crowd can thank the bitching/moaning/lawsuits/lemon arbitrations of the dissatisfied Cayenne crowd for moving PAG back to the top of the JDPower quality award standings.. and the Panamera, I suspect will also be a near flawless launch as a result of the "pepper" that often had to be sprinkled on PCNA's head! Now, Porsche can correctly say that the Cayenne is the best SUV on the planet. While I only have a S (for my needs it is quick enough and gets nearly 20MPG highway/15 around town even with aggressive driving), the Turbo version is "wicked fast" and incredibly well-appointed, etc.
